9 Supplement

9.1 Technical data

General data
Material 316L corresponds to 1.4404 or 1.4435
Materials, wetted parts
- Process fitting - Thread

316L

- Process fitting - Flange

316L

- Process seal

Klingersil C-4400

- Tuning fork

316L

- Extension tube ø 43 mm (1.7 in)

316L

Materials, non-wetted parts
- Housing

Plastic PBT (Polyester), Alu die-casting pow-

der-coated, 316L

- Seal ring between housing and

housing cover

NBR (stainless steel housing), silicone (Alu/

plastic housing)

- Ground terminal

316L

Weights
- with plastic housing

1500 g (53 oz)

- with Aluminium housing

1950 g (69 oz)

- with stainless steel housing

2300 g (81 oz)

Max. lateral load

600 N (135 lbf) longitudinal to the fork side

Output variable
Output

Two-wire output

Suitable signal conditioning instruments

VEGATOR 536Ex, 537Ex, 636Ex

Output signal
- Mode min.

Vibrating element uncovered - 16 mA ±1 mA;

vibrating element covered - 8 mA ±1 mA

- Mode max.

Vibrating element uncovered - 8 mA ±1 mA;

vibrating element covered - 16 mA ±1 mA

- Fault signal

<2.3 mA

Modes (adjustable)

min./max.

Integration time
- when immersed

approx. 0.5 s

- when laid bare

approx. 1 s
